Output 68c6c89f5f07e9f55144b6fa0ed800aa5885dae644c66d415031e879fa382092:19

value
91000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e53b5c8e4b24db84f999c77ec6e5352a824d5d55 OP_EQUAL
address
3Nb5mz7LbXZT8AMDqigPkBS2unyr25iGb5
transaction
68c6c89f5f07e9f55144b6fa0ed800aa5885dae644c66d415031e879fa382092
spent
true